Circa 1933 Ernest Jones Hickory Shafted Practice Swing Club - Patented
Ernest Jones had a penchant for golf instruction, more so after serving in World War I and losing his leg. He found he was still able to play a respectable round of golf, even though his body and they way he played had drastically changed. he moved to New York City in the early 1920's as a club professional and began giving indoor golf lessons, as it kept the student from being distracted by the loft of the ball. Some of Jones' notable students included Horton Smith, Henry Cotton, and Glenna Collett Vare. Offered here is Jones' hickory shafted Practice Swing Club. The neck is made from a heavy spring. Jones patented this club around 1933, no doubt to go along with the lessons he taught in person. This club presents in great condition and measures 39 3/4".
